1. Hiking the Famous Pulpit Rock: A Must-Do Stavanger Adventure

1. Hiking the Famous Pulpit Rock: A Must-Do Stavanger Adventure

Aurora.wo2023., CC BY-ND 2.0, via Flickr

Hiking to the Pulpit Rock is undeniably one of the most popular Stavanger adventures. This magnificent rock formation towers over the Lysefjord and offers breathtaking views that reward every step of the journey. The trail, which is about 8 kilometers long, typically takes around 4 to 5 hours to complete. While the hike can be steep at times, the stunning landscape and fresh air make it worth the effort.

As you ascend, you’ll enjoy beautiful scenery, lush forests, and maybe even spot some local wildlife. Don’t forget to snap a few pictures at the top, as the panoramic view of the fjord is truly spectacular! Many hikers recommend starting early in the morning to avoid the crowds and get the best sunrise views.

2. Exploring the Historic Gamle Stavanger: A Peek Into the Past

2. Exploring the Historic Gamle Stavanger: A Peek Into the Past

Aurora.wo2023., CC BY-ND 2.0, via Flickr

A visit to Gamle Stavanger is a must for history enthusiasts. This charming area is known for its well-preserved wooden houses that date back to the 18th and 19th centuries. Walking through the cobblestone streets, you feel as though you’ve stepped back in time. Many of these houses are decorated with beautiful flowers, making the neighborhood picturesque.

Additionally, Gamle Stavanger hosts various art galleries, craft shops, and cafes. Therefore, you can easily spend a lovely afternoon here, exploring local culture while enjoying a cup of coffee. I recommend visiting the Stavanger Maritime Museum nearby to learn about the city’s rich maritime history.

7. Visiting the Norwegian Petroleum Museum: Dive Into Stavanger’s Industry

The Norwegian Petroleum Museum offers an insightful journey into the heart of Stavanger’s industry. As I explored its exhibits, I discovered how oil transformed the region economically and socially. This museum is not just about oil; it provides a comprehensive look at the technology and innovations in the petroleum sector.

Among the Highlights, interactive displays and multimedia presentations keep visitors engaged. Additionally, the architecture of the museum itself is a visual treat, blending modern design with nature. Furthermore, the museum’s proximity to the harbor offers lovely views of the surrounding area. Don’t miss the chance to learn through guided tours which provide deeper insights into Stavanger’s vital role in the global oil market.

8. Savoring Local Cuisine: A Culinary Adventure in Stavanger

When visiting Stavanger, indulging in local cuisine is a must! The city is known for its fresh seafood, particularly salmon and cod. Local restaurants often serve traditional dishes that reflect the region’s rich maritime heritage. For instance, trying the famous klippfisk, salted and dried cod, is essential for an authentic experience.

Moreover, food markets in Stavanger showcase local farmers and artisans. Exploring these markets offers not only fresh produce but also a taste of the regional delicacies. Don’t forget to try brunost, a delicious brown cheese that adds a unique flavor to Norwegian dishes. To enjoy the full culinary adventure, consider joining a guided food tour to sample various specialties and learn about their origins.

9. Discovering the Stunning Kjeragbolten: A Rock Between Two Cliffs

Kjeragbolten is one of the most iconic sights on a Stavanger adventure. This remarkable boulder is wedged between two cliffs, offering some of the most breathtaking views in Norway. Hiking to Kjeragbolten is a popular activity among tourists and locals alike, providing an exhilarating experience and stunning photo opportunities.

The trek to reach Kjeragbolten is moderately challenging, taking approximately 5 hours round trip. As you ascend, the scenery transforms from lush greenery to dramatic cliffs and shimmering fjords. Once at the top, standing on this magnificent rock gives you a thrilling sense of accomplishment. Just remember to take pictures – it’s a moment worth capturing for your travel memories!

10. Exploring Viking History at the Stavanger Cathedral: Heritage Awaits

Visiting the Stavanger Cathedral is an essential stop for anyone interested in Viking history. This remarkable cathedral, completed in 1125, is the oldest in Norway and stands as a testament to the country’s rich heritage. As you walk through its stunning arches, the echoes of the past resonate with every step.

Moreover, the cathedral’s architecture is a blend of Romanesque and Gothic styles, making it a visual feast for history buffs and architecture enthusiasts alike. Interestingly, the stone used to construct the cathedral was sourced from local quarries, further connecting it to Stavanger’s geological landscape. As you explore the stained glass windows and intricate carvings, you can almost imagine the stories of the Vikings who once roamed these lands.

Beyond the cathedral, the surrounding area is steeped in history as well. With many historic buildings nearby, you can spend hours soaking in the atmosphere that tells the tale of Stavanger’s past. I highly recommend taking a guided tour to fully appreciate the historical significance of this destination.
